Q: Is 664,520,510 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 664,520,510 is a composite number.

Why is 664,520,510 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 664,520,510 can be evenly divided by 1 2 5 10 4,421 8,842 15,031 22,105 30,062 44,210 75,155 150,310 66,452,051 132,904,102 332,260,255 and 664,520,510, with no remainder.

Since 664,520,510 cannot be divided by just 1 and 664,520,510, it is a composite number.
